#include "wabt/token.h"
namespace wabt {
const char* GetTokenTypeName(TokenType token_type) {
static const char* s_names[] = {
#define WABT_TOKEN(name, string) string,
#define WABT_TOKEN_FIRST(name, string)
#define WABT_TOKEN_LAST(name, string)
#include "wabt/token.def"
#undef WABT_TOKEN
#undef WABT_TOKEN_FIRST
#undef WABT_TOKEN_LAST
};
static_assert(
WABT_ARRAY_SIZE(s_names) == WABT_ENUM_COUNT(TokenType),
"Expected TokenType names list length to match number of TokenTypes." );
int x = static_cast <int>(token_type);
if (x < WABT_ENUM_COUNT(TokenType)) {
return s_names[x];
}
return "Invalid" ;
}
Token::Token(Location loc, TokenType token_type)
: loc(loc), token_type_(token_type) {
assert(IsTokenTypeBare(token_type_));
}
Token::Token(Location loc, TokenType token_type, Type type)
: loc(loc), token_type_(token_type) {
assert(HasType());
Construct(type_, type);
}
Token::Token(Location loc, TokenType token_type, std::string_view text)
: loc(loc), token_type_(token_type) {
assert(HasText());
Construct(text_, text);
}
Token::Token(Location loc, TokenType token_type, Opcode opcode)
: loc(loc), token_type_(token_type) {
assert(HasOpcode());
Construct(opcode_, opcode);
}
Token::Token(Location loc, TokenType token_type, const Literal& literal)
: loc(loc), token_type_(token_type) {
assert(HasLiteral());
Construct(literal_, literal);
}
std::string Token::to_string() const {
if (IsTokenTypeBare(token_type_)) {
return GetTokenTypeName(token_type_);
} else if (HasLiteral()) {
return std::string(literal_.text);
} else if (HasOpcode()) {
return opcode_.GetName();
} else if (HasText()) {
return std::string(text_);
} else if (IsTokenTypeRefKind(token_type_)) {
return type_.GetRefKindName();
} else {
assert(HasType());
return type_.GetName();
}
}
std::string Token::to_string_clamp(size_t max_length) const {
std::string s = to_string();
if (s.length() > max_length) {
return s.substr(0 , max_length - 3 ) + "..." ;
} else {
return s;
}
}
} // namespace wabt
